Immunohistochemistry (Frozen sections) - Alexa Fluor® 488 Anti-SV2A antibody [EPR23500-32] (AB317770)
Immunofluorescence staining of SV2A in a section of frozen mouse pancreas.
The section was fixed using 10% formaldehyde in 1X PBS for 10 minutes. No antigen retrieval step was performed prior to staining. Performed on a Leica BONDTM. The section was incubated at room temperature for 1 hour with ab317770 at 1/50 dilution (shown in green). Nuclear DNA was labelled with DAPI (shown in blue). The section was then mounted using Dako Fluorescence Mounting Medium®.
Image was taken with a confocal microscope (Leica-Microsystems, TCS SP8).
For other IHC staining systems (automated and non-automated), customers should optimize variable parameters such as antigen retrieval conditions, antibody concentrations and incubation times.

Immunocytochemistry/ Immunofluorescence - Alexa Fluor® 488 Anti-SV2A antibody [EPR23500-32] (AB317770)
ab317770 staining SV2A in primary mouse neurons/glia, DIV14 cells (prepared from E18 mouse hippocampal brain area, obtained from Transnetyx Tissue by BrainBits, LLC, cat.no. C57EHP). The cells were fixed with 100% methanol (5 min), permeabilised with 0.1% Triton x-100 for 5 minutes and then blocked with 1% BSA/10% normal goat serum/0.3M glycine in 0.1% PBS-Tween for 1h. The cells were then incubated overnight at +4°C with ab317770 at 5 ug/ml (shown in green). ab190573, Rabbit monoclonal to alpha Tubulin (Alexa Fluor® 647) (shown in magenta) was used at 2 ug/ml for structural counterstaining.
Image was acquired with a confocal microscope (Leica-Microsystems TCS SP8) and a single confocal section is shown.
This product also work with 4% formaldehyde (10 min) fixation under the same testing conditions.
